Who we are:

BRL Architects is a progressive architectural practice established over 30 years ago in Plymouth, Devon. Operating from our principle address in Plymouth and an office in Fulham, we have built a strong reputation for designing high quality buildings that creatively add value for our clients. We are recognised nationally for our versatile portfolio of work around the country.

Founded in 1989, our continued growth and success over the past three decades has been made possible by our inspired team of innovative professionals. Our ability to combine commercial awareness with practical experience adds considerable value to our work regardless of size or scope.

What we do:

We have built up considerable expertise in the residential sector, with many apartment and housing projects now successfully completed. The scope of work in the residential sector ranges from affordable to luxury developments. Commercial projects including hotels, restaurants, offices, retail parks, warehousing, educational, community and health facilities also feature within the practice profile. The practice is also recognised nationally for its portfolio of major leisure facilities around the UK.

Your role will involve:

- Leading your team and running complex, large scale projects

- Produce tender and construction documentation, including all technical drawings and specifications

- Running multiple projects at once with the ability to delegate effectively

- Clear and regular communication with everyone involved on each project

- Occasional travel to project sites around the UK

The Ideal Candidate:

- Due to our commitment to delivering projects to BIM level 2, a detailed knowledge and technical understanding of Building Information Modelling would be highly advantageous

- We use Revit for all projects at all design stages, so technical experience in this software is essential, including Navisworks

- Experience of specification writing using NBS Create

- A thorough knowledge of UK Building Regulations is essential

- Experience of working on large scale multi-million pound projects in the Leisure and Residential sectors

- Extensive on-site job running experience

- A minimum of 5 years’ experience working within an Architectural Practice

- Must be self-motivated with the ability to manage your time and productivity effectively

- The ability to interpret briefs, work to deadlines and be adaptable whilst working to strict deadlines/budgets
